Percy/Simpson Win Day Five at Star World Championship

Miami, Florida, USA: Big wind shifts from the Northwest to the East with winds ranging from 8 to 20 knots were accommodated with two start line resets and a change on the course after the second weather mark today in the 2008 Star World Championships at Coral Reef Yacht Club.

Iain Percy and crew Andrew Simpson (GBR) took first place and sailed like the world champions they are. However, their black flag in race two and a disqualification in race four, put them out of the running for anything but a mid-fleet finish overall. Diego Negri/Luigi Viale (ITA) finished second and John Dane/Austin Sperry (USA) came in third.

The Polish team of Mateusz Kusznierewicz/Dominik Zycki, current holders of the number one ISAF ranking for the Star Class, finished fourth today and moved into first place overall after the fifth race in the six race series.

The Japanese team of Kunio Suzuki/Daichi Wada, which is trying to qualify its country for the Olympics, finished 19th today and jumped from 23rd to 11th overall. Other countries still racing for the four available Olympic slots are Austria, Ireland, Croatia and Switzerland. — Janet Maizner

Top 10 Standing after five races and lowest score discarded:

1. Mateusz Kusznierewicz / Dominik Zycki, POL, 9.00
2. Diego Negri / Luigi Viale, ITA, 17.00
3. Robert Scheidt / Bruno Prada, BRA, 29.00
4. Hamish Pepper / Carl Williams, NZL, 32.00
5. Marc Pickel / Ingo Borkowski, GER, 34.00
6. Mark Mendelblatt / Mark Strube, USA, 36.00
7. Flavio Marazzi / Enrico De Maria, SUI, 38.00
8. Xavier Rohart / Pascal Rambeau, FRA, 46.00
9. Fredrik Loof / Anders Ekdstrom, SWE, 49.00
9. Iain Murray / Andrew Palfrey, AUS, 51.00
